London, UK. 14 February, 2017: 63 percent of adults avoid mobile apps because of too many adverts, or when asked to pay for the app or extra features. This is the finding of an independent study of 600 mobile app users in the UK and US, commissioned by Tutela, the Wireless Analytics Monetisation (WAM) firm.
